Company Description: Systemiq is the system change company, working to accelerate the transition to a net-zero, nature-positive and more inclusive economy. As a certified B Corp, we partner with business, finance, policymakers and civil society to transform five interconnected systems: energy, nature and food, materials and circularity, sustainable finance, and urban transformation.

We bring together strategy, policy, market design and capital mobilisation to deliver tangible results in the real economy. Founded in 2016, Systemiq has grown to a global team of more than 300 people across Brazil, France, Germany, Indonesia, Kenya, the Netherlands, the UK and the US, united by a singular focus on sustainability.

Role Overview

As a Manager at Systemiq, you will be responsible for leading key projects, managing complex multi-stakeholder relationships, and driving impactful sustainability initiatives. You will take ownership of multiple workstreams, oversee project delivery, and guide teams in designing and implementing strategic interventions across sustainability, economic transition, and systems transformation themes.

You will play a critical role in translating technical, policy, market, and sustainability insights into action, ensuring high-quality project execution and supporting clients and partners to deliver practical, scalable impact.

We are looking for an experienced leader with expertise in sustainability transitions, decarbonisation, energy systems, climate, sustainable finance, or related fields, combined with strong project management skills and a demonstrated ability to drive impact through cross-sector collaboration.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and oversee multiple workstreams, ensuring successful project execution and high-impact outcomes.
  • Develop and maintain strategic relationships with stakeholders across the private sector, government, financial institutions, NGOs, and academia.
  • Support the design and implementation of strategic interventions across sustainability transition themes, including energy transition, climate, land use, industrial transformation, and sustainable finance.
  • Conduct and oversee qualitative and quantitative analysis to generate insights that inform decision-making and strategy.
  • Provide strategic advisory support to partners and clients on sustainability transition challenges and opportunities.
  • Lead and mentor junior team members, fostering a collaborative and high-performing team culture.
  • Contribute to thought leadership, including development of insights, frameworks, and recommendations related to sustainability and systems change.

Requirements

Mindset, Skills & Experience

We are seeking candidates who demonstrate a strong commitment to Systemiq’s mission and a passion for systems change.

Ideal candidates will bring:

  • Master’s degree or equivalent in economics, engineering, environmental science, business, public policy, finance, sustainability, or related fields.
  • 6+ years of experience in consulting, strategy, project management, sustainable finance, climate, energy transition, infrastructure, or sustainability-focused roles.
  • Strong understanding of sustainability transition topics, including exposure to areas such as energy systems, decarbonisation, climate policy, sustainable finance, industrial transformation, nature, or land use.
  • Proven ability to lead teams, manage complex projects, and engage senior stakeholders.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ities, including experience synthesising complex information into actionable insights.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Entrepreneurial and adaptable mindset, with the ability to operate effectively in fast-paced and evolving environments.
  • Experience mentoring and developing junior colleagues.
  • Full fluency in English, both written and spoken.
